我正在使用Couchbase 4.0 beta和java-client 2.1.3。
Bucket.get(id)
返回JsonDocument
,我可以从中获取id
和cas
以及内容。现在我想使用N1QL (select *)
查询二级索引。但是,QueryResult
仅返回JsonObject
的行,这些行只是文档内容。无论如何我还可以获得元数据(id
和cas
)吗?
答案 0 :(得分:8)
您可以执行以下操作:
SELECT b, meta(b) AS meta FROM my_bucket b;